Abstract

The invention relates to an automation device, in which a plurality of spatially distributed functional units communicate with one another by means of a common transmission protocol. The device has a microcontroller (110) which has at least one associated clock generator (120) and a memory unit (150) and which is connected at least to a data source (140), which is designed to output a data byte stream to be transmitted. A first program for conversion of a data byte stream to be transmitted to a sequence of sample values of an adequate frequency-modulated line signal, and a second program for identification of a frequency-modulated line signal and for its sequential conversion to a received data byte stream are stored in the memory unit (150), with these programs being associated with the microcontroller (110). The first and the second program can be run alternately.
